Be a Vital Link in Healthcare Excellence

Vail Health is looking for an organized and motivated Inventory Specialist to help ensure that our clinical teams have the right supplies at the right time. If you enjoy working behind the scenes to support frontline care and thrive in a fast-paced environment where accuracy matters-this is the role for you.

What You'll Do

As an Inventory Specialist, you'll be a key part of our Supply Chain team. Your day-to-day work helps clinical teams focus on patient care by making sure supplies and equipment are accurate, available, and ready when needed.

  • Maintain accurate inventory levels through restocking, cycle counting, and inventory control for assigned areas.

  • Review supply needs, prevent overstocking, and help ensure efficient product turnover.

  • Conduct physical counts and investigate inventory discrepancies-updating systems as needed.

  • Process supply deliveries by verifying quantities, expiration dates, and physical condition.

  • Respond to supply and equipment requests-both routine and urgent-with prompt, professional service.

  • Inspect equipment and supplies for expiration, recalls, or defects, and report any issues.

  • Help manage bi-annual physical inventories and assist with reporting for supply tracking.

  • Keep all supply areas clean, organized, and well-maintained throughout daily operations.

  • Propose new ideas and assist with department initiatives aimed at continuous improvement.

  • Maintain confidentiality and HIPAA compliance in all work.
